Deamination is the process by which amino acids are broken down, releasing ammonia as a byproduct. Ammonia is toxic to the body in high concentrations, so it must be converted into a less toxic compound, such as urea before it can be excreted in the urine.

This process is called the urea cycle, which happens in the liver. Urea is the end product of nitrogen metabolism in mammals.

Ketone bodies are produced by the liver as an alternate energy source when glucose is in short supply, such as during fasting or in uncontrolled diabetes. Acetyl CoA is a molecule that plays a central role in the metabolism of carbohydrates and fats.

A condyloid joint is a form of synovial joint in which one bone's articular surface has an ovoid convexity that sits within the other bone's ellipsoidal hollow. It permits movement in two planes (i.e., flexion or extension, abduction or adduction).

Condyloid joints, like saddle joints, provide for two degrees of freedom of movement. Such joints permit movement such as abduction/adduction and flexion/extension (circumduction). The ball and socket joint allows axial rotation but not the condyloid joint.

Condyloid joints, in other words, have non-axial motions. Due to the oval form of the joints, however, minimal circumduction may be achieved at such joints.

Although the fingers are small, limited circular motion is possible. The bottom joint of each finger is a condyloid joint. In the proper functioning of the hand, these joints have an important role. With the help of joint capsules, surrounding musculotendinous structures, and ligaments, flexibility and stability of fingers can be achieved.

Most E. coli antisense RNAs work with a protein called Hfq to regulate their target mRNAs.

The Hfq protein (also known as HF-I protein) encoded by the Hfq gene was discovered in 1968 as an Escherichia coli host factor that is important for bacteriophage replication. It is now clear that Hfq is an abundant bacterial RNA-binding protein with many important physiological roles, usually mediated through interactions with Hfq-binding sRNA.

Hfq mediates its pleiotropic effect through multiple mechanisms. These interact with regulatory sRNAs and facilitate their antisense interactions with their targets. It also acts independently to modulate mRNA decay (directing the mRNA transcript to decay) and also acts as a repressor of mRNA translation.

Basalt is a type of igneous rock that forms from cooled volcanic lava. It is composed mainly of the minerals plagioclase feldspar and pyroxene, and is typically black or dark gray in color.

Because of its high density and hard, dense mineral grains, basalt is relatively resistant to weathering and erosion. Additionally, the fine-grained texture of basalt makes it difficult for water and other erosional agents to penetrate and break down the rock.

Note that Sandstone and limestone are also relatively hard rocks, but they are composed mainly of grains of sedimentary rock and can be less resistant to weathering and erosion than basalt. Shale is a sedimentary rock that is composed mainly of clay-sized particles and can be relatively easy to erode.

Superb examples of evolutionary adaptations are warning colour and mimicry. Because we are extremely visual mammals, we can easily comprehend the outcomes of visual adaptations like these. The purpose of warning colour is to prevent prey from assaulting species with active defences.

Warning colours are often (but not always) bright and noticeable. Bright, contrasty warning patterns, like traffic signs, are generally simpler to learn: they are advertising colours.

In practise, brightly coloured creatures known to be guarded, such as wasps and distasteful Heliconius butterflies, are considered to be aposematic - despite the fact that little experimental data suggests they are simpler to learn.

To a first approximation, learning a warning colour necessitates that the per capita loss during learning reduces as the number of warning colours in a population increases. After been irritated by a warning pattern, predators will learn to avoid other individuals with the same colour pattern, regardless of density.

As a result, the proportion taken decreases as the density of the warning-colored prey increases. As a result, warning colours provide a frequency-dependent fitness benefit that grows as the frequency of warning colours grows. Polymorphisms are hence not expected, and are seldom found, within populations of warningly-colored animals.

When the bulk of a predator population recognises the warning pattern, crypsis should become unfavourable, and hiding should no longer be advantageous.
